The thesis explores the implications of rising human activities on area protection within polar regions, specifically the Arctic and Antarctic. It examines the legal frameworks governing these areas, focusing on comparative legal systems and their effectiveness in addressing environmental concerns. By analyzing various legal approaches, the work highlights the challenges and potential strategies for balancing human interests with the need for conservation in these fragile ecosystems. The study contributes to the understanding of polar law and its relevance in contemporary legal discussions.
